Loft Conversions in Cambridgeshire

Cambridgeshire's housing market has driven strong demand for loft conversions, particularly around Cambridge city and commuter towns like Royston and Huntingdon where space premiums are high. The county's mixed character—combining university-town density with extensive rural areas and fenland settlements—means many homeowners are seeking to add value and living space rather than relocate. Period properties dominate much of the county, especially Victorian and Edwardian terraces and semi-detached homes that are ideal candidates for loft conversion work. This housing stock, combined with relatively limited new-build development in many areas, has made loft conversions an attractive option for families looking to expand without moving.

Planning permission requirements in Cambridgeshire vary significantly depending on whether a property sits within a conservation area—common in Cambridge itself and many village centres—where stricter controls on roof alterations and dormers may apply. Many rural and semi-rural properties in the fenlands are also subject to flood risk assessments, which can affect structural requirements and may influence conversion feasibility or cost. Homeowners should be aware that older properties across the county often have limited structural capacity or complex roof geometries that require specialist surveying and can increase labour costs, while access for materials and equipment in tight Cambridge streets or remote rural locations may add to project timescales and contractor callout fees.

Questions to ask your loft conversion before booking

Are you registered with a recognised scheme for loft conversion work?
Look for membership of the Federation of Master Builders (FMB) or TrustMark, both of which vet builders for quality and require adherence to a code of conduct. If structural alterations are involved, confirm they use or work alongside a Structural Engineer registered with the Institution of Structural Engineers (IStructE) or CIAT, as this provides professional accountability for the most safety-critical elements of the build.
What documents and guarantees will your written quote include?
A proper quote should detail the full scope of works, materials specifications, payment schedule, projected timeline, and confirmation that Building Regulations approval will be obtained, resulting in a completion certificate issued by the local authority or an Approved Inspector. Be cautious if there is no mention of structural calculations, party wall agreement considerations where relevant, or a written guarantee on workmanship, as these omissions can leave you unprotected and affect your ability to sell the property later.
How will you ensure the new floor can handle the additional load?
An experienced converter will always commission structural calculations to confirm that existing ceiling joists must be replaced or supplemented with new engineered floor joists rated for habitable room loads, rather than simply building on top of what is there. If a contractor claims the existing joists are fine without having seen a structural engineer's report, this is a strong indicator they are cutting corners in a way that could compromise the safety and legality of the entire conversion.

Do I need planning permission for a loft conversion?
Most loft conversions fall within permitted development rights and do not need planning permission, provided they meet size and position limits (typically 40m³ for terraced houses, 50m³ for semis/detached). Exceptions include mansards, hip-to-gable conversions, properties in conservation areas, and adding a balcony. Your builder will advise.
How much does a loft conversion cost?
A Velux (roof light) conversion is the simplest and cheapest at £20,000–£35,000. A dormer adds significantly more space and costs £30,000–£50,000. A mansard conversion (popular in London terraces) runs £45,000–£70,000. Prices include structural work, insulation, staircase, electrics and plastering.
How long does a loft conversion take?
A Velux conversion takes 4–6 weeks. A dormer conversion takes 8–12 weeks. A mansard or hip-to-gable can take 3–4 months. Planning permission (if required) adds 8–12 weeks before building work starts.
Does a loft conversion add value to my home?
A loft conversion typically adds 15–25% to a property's value — often exceeding the cost of the work in areas where bedroom count is a key price driver. An extra bedroom with en-suite is the most valuable use of the space. Always check with a local estate agent before committing to the scale of the project.
